What is a Physics Calculator?


A physics calculator is a specialized tool that helps users carry out mathematical computations related to physics. These calculators manage estimations involving different physical quantities, such as distance, speed, force, energy, and more, while also supporting units conversion and formula application. Physics calculators can vary from easy online tools to advanced software application and apps equipped with built-in physics principles.

Key Features to Look For

  1. User-Friendly Interface: A clean and intuitive style makes it simpler for users to browse.
  2. Unit Conversion: Enables fast conversions in between different physical units, which is essential in physics.
  3. Graphing Capabilities: Ideal for understanding relationships between variables.
  4. Built-in Formulas: Access to common physics formulas that can streamline the computation process.
  5. Step-by-Step Solutions: This feature helps users discover by supplying a clear breakdown of the computations.

Benefits of Using Physics Calculators


Physics calculators offer a number of benefits, enhancing the performance of calculations and fostering a better understanding of physics principles. Here are a few of the main benefits:

  1. Time Savings: Calculators can carry out complicated computations quickly, saving important time, particularly in examinations and high-pressure circumstances.

  2. Increased Accuracy: Automated estimations minimize the threat of human error, making sure more accurate results.

  3. Boosted Learning: Physics calculators with detailed solutions assist students understand the analytical process instead of simply providing answers.

  4. Accessibility: Many physics calculators are offered online, making them quickly accessible from anywhere with an internet connection.

  5. Simulation and Visualization: Advanced calculators and software application enable users to envision physical phenomena and examine data through simulations, helping with much deeper understanding.

Frequently Asked Questions (FAQ)


1. What is the very best online physics calculator for students?

While the choice depends upon particular needs, Symbolab and Desmos are frequently considered exceptional options for their easy to use interfaces and academic material.

2. Can physics calculators fix complicated issues instantly?

Yes, numerous advanced physics calculators are developed to supply instant options to complex physics equations and problems, improving the finding out process.

3. Exist any free physics calculators?

Absolutely! Numerous online calculators, including options like Khan Academy and Desmos, deal entirely totally free access to users.

4. Can I use physics calculators in examinations?

This depends upon your institution's policies. Some tests allow the usage of scientific calculators, while others may have limitations against calculator usage completely. Always inspect in advance.

5. Are graphing calculators necessary for physics?

While not strictly needed, graphing calculators can substantially aid in comprehending graphs and relationships between variables, making them a valuable resource for students and professionals alike.
